Fragomen is a strategic partner of the GME Leaders Exchange, London where Fragomen Partner Julia Onslow-Cole will be a key contributor. In addition, Fragomen Partners Louise Haycock and Rajiv Naik will join the discussion around 'The Evolving Role of Global Mobility in Organisational Strategy' during this breakfast briefing.
The discussion will cover the following topics:
The Expanding Role of Global Mobility
Global Mobility is moving beyond compliance and relocation to become a critical partner in driving talent and business strategy. The discussion will explore how GM contributes to leadership development, succession planning, and the deployment of global skills aligned with organisational goals.
Strategic Integration with Talent Functions
According to the report, 70% of organisations now report closer integration between Global Mobility and Talent. Attendees will share experiences and best practices on how this alignment strengthens leadership pipelines, enhances skills deployment, and improves the employee experience.
Shifting Priorities for 2025 and Beyond
While compliance and cost control remain essential, new priorities have emerged — including agility, employee experience, and alignment with ESG and sustainability objectives. The group will discuss how these evolving priorities are shaping mobility strategies for the years ahead.
Policy Transformation and Flexibility
With 60% of organisations redesigning their mobility frameworks, flexibility has become a key competitive differentiator. Attendees will examine how personalised mobility solutions can combine consistent global standards with local adaptability to attract, retain, and empower diverse talent populations.
